Navigating the Road to Compliance: Essential Strategies for Trucking Companies

In today’s fast-paced logistics world, ensuring compliance with regulations is more important than ever for trucking companies. Regulations like the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) guidelines require a complex understanding of safety, environmental, and operational standards. As companies navigate this intricate landscape, employing effective compliance strategies becomes crucial for sustainable operations. Below, we explore essential strategies that trucking companies can adopt to fortify their compliance frameworks.


Understanding Compliance Frameworks


Before diving into strategies, it’s essential for trucking companies to understand what compliance entails. Compliance regulations can include:



  • Vehicle Maintenance Standards: Adhering to maintenance checks to ensure vehicle safety.

  • Hours of Service (HOS): Following regulations on how many hours a driver can operate a vehicle.

  • Drug and Alcohol Testing: Implementing a stringent testing program for drivers.

  • Environmental Regulations: Following regulations related to emissions and fuel usage.


Failure to comply can result in hefty penalties, shutdowns, and damage to reputation. Understanding these frameworks allows companies to lay the groundwork for robust compliance strategies.


1. Regular Training and Education


One of the most effective strategies for ensuring compliance is to provide regular training and education for all employees. Regular workshops and online courses can help keep drivers, mechanics, and administrative staff informed of the latest regulations and industry best practices. Training should cover:



  • The importance of HOS regulations and managing fatigue.

  • Daily vehicle inspection protocols.

  • Proper procedures for reporting compliance violations.


Continued education fosters a culture of compliance, where workers understand the gravity of adhering to regulations and are empowered to report any irregularities.


2. Implementing Technology Solutions


Incorporating technology solutions can simplify compliance processes significantly. Fleet management syst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and compliance management software can automate numerous compliance tasks. These tools can:

  • Track driver hours and ensure adherence to HOS regulations.

  • Schedule and document vehicle maintenance and inspections.

  • Provide real-time data on vehicle performance, reducing risks associated with unsafe conditions.


By leveraging technology, trucking companies can increase efficiency, reduce human error, and enhance overall compliance performance.


3. Conducting Regular Audits and Assessments


Regular audits are vital for maintaining compliance. Companies should conduct internal audits and risk assessments to identify gaps in their compliance framework. These audits can help in:



  • Reviewing adherence to safety regulations.

  • Evaluating the effectiveness of training programs.

  • Identifying potential compliance risks before they escalate.


Additionally, external audits by third-party organizations can provide an unbiased perspective on compliance status, aiding in transparency and accountability.


4. Building a Compliance Culture


Creating a culture of compliance within the organization is essential. This can be achieved by:



  • Encouraging open communication about compliance issues.

  • Recognizing and rewarding employees who adhere to compliance protocols.

  • Involving all departments in compliance practices, from drivers to management.


When compliance is seen as a collective responsibility rather than just a regulatory burden, organizations are more likely to achieve consistent adherence to regulations.


5. Staying Informed about Regulatory Changes


Regulations are not static; they are continually evolving. Companies must stay informed about regulatory changes that could impact their operations. This involves subscribing to industry newsletters, attending conferences, and participating in relevant workshops. Key areas to focus on include:



  • New federal and state regulations.

  • Changes in environmental standards.

  • Amendments to HOS rules and safety regulations.


By staying proactive, companies can adapt to changes quickly, mitigating the risks associated with non-compliance.

6. Establishing a Compliance Team


Lastly, establishing a dedicated compliance team can significantly enhance efforts to maintain adherence to regulatory standards. This team can undertake the following:



  • Monitor compliance status continuously.

  • Develop and implement compliance strategies.

  • Serve as a resource for employees with compliance-related queries.


A dedicated team provides the expertise and focus necessary to navigate the complexities of compliance effectively.


Conclusion


Navigating the road to compliance is an ongoing challenge for trucking companies, but with the right strategies in place, it can be managed effectively. By prioritizing training, leveraging technology, conducting regular audits, and fostering a compliance culture, companies can not only meet regulatory standards but excel in their operational efficiency and reputation. Staying informed about changes in regulations and dedicating resources to compliance further solidifies a company’s commitment to safety and reliability in the trucking industry.
